I couldn't care less how thick he is, as long as he performs on the pitch Laughing .

I presume he left his Porsche there when he flew over to sign his initial loan deal and has never returned to Spain since (he's just signed a permanent deal).

I don't know if you know much about Pennant, but he grew up the son of a smack dealer (his dad was 'stung' by undercover NOTW reporters a couple of years ago, still operating a smack den), was the first pro footballer to play whilst wearing an electronic tag and once got arrested for driving offences and gave his name as "Ashley Cole" Laughing . Despite his rough upbringing and dubious career decisions/discipline he seems to have settled down at Stoke and become quite the professional.

On the other hand top level football is a billion pound industry, funded by all us plebs who pay to watch it, pay for the shirts and generally follow it and in some cases people build their lives around it.

Regardless of how irritating it is to see such young and in some cases undeserving men paid so much ultimately they are workers of their industry and they have made sure they get what the market thinks they are worth. Im sure the owners/shareholders of the clubs would love to pay their players less and profit more of the income but they know they would then never have decent enough players to compete.
